Chevron is one of the few companies globally where it is invested across the specialty value chain from Base Oil, to Additives and finally the sales of final Lubricants products marketed globally. To empower the industries, we serve by harnessing our unique integrated value chain to deliver superior, reliable, and innovative solutions that help our customers win - while stewarding a resilient portfolio that enables long-term financial performance and strengthens enterprise value. As a result of this new organizational structure, we now have an opportunity for a senior financial adviser to support this aggregated business, reporting to the Global Finance Head based in Singapore. The remote supervisory requires this candidate to be independent and a proactive go-getter.
Responsibilities for this position may include but are not limited to: 1) Annual Business Plan Development & Managing Financial Forecast
Partner with respective Finance teams across the value chain (and aligned organizations) to develop the
annual five-year business plan
and develop
summary presentations
for leadership reviews.
Coordinate plan submission, quality checks, and follow-ups to ensure plans meet expectations for timeliness, completeness, and internal consistency.
Regularly review the internal partner organization billing process to ensure equity and consistency in approach, helping to champion dialogues when there are gaps or improvement opportunities. This is inherently part of the Business Plan process.
2) Executive Communications & Materials & Partnering
Lead the
development and delivery of monthly and ad-hoc executive‑level presentation materials
and communication packages for senior leadership.
Translate complex topics, assumptions, and trade‑offs into
clear, concise narratives
suitable for executive audiences.
3) Competitive Performance & Benchmarking
Support and partner the Specialty business to both validate cashflow improvement ideas in both the ideation and close out of initiatives identified as part of the overall gap-to-competitive-goal through external benchmarking.
The candidate is expected to synthesize large data and help identify performance gaps, trends, and improvement opportunities. Integrate competitive insights are integrated to inform leadership discussions and strategic and tactical decision-making.
4) Cross‑Functional & Global Collaboration
Build strong working relationships and act as a connector across Specialty Sales businesses, finance and other partner organizations to drive alignment, partner better and deliver results. The end objective is to evolve into a global service delivery model that is both effective and efficient.
Required Qualifications
Degree in Finance, Accounting, or related business field; MBA and/or CPA is preferred.
12 to 15 years of progressive experience in Finance, with recent supervisor experience. Experience working in complex, matrixed, and multicultural environments or previously exposed to the energy industry is preferred.
Strong understanding of
financial fundamentals
and a strategic thinker with a hands‑on approach that also possess excellent stakeholder management skills.
Proven ability to operate as a
individual contributor but also as a coach , providing guidance and influencing outcomes without direct authority. Aspires to lead.
